An article in cancer research [“analyses of litter-matched time-to-response data, with modifications for recovery of interlitter information” (1977, vol. 37, pp. 3863–3868)] tested the tumorigenesis of a drug. rats were randomly selected from litters and given the drug. the times of tumor appearance were recorded as follows: 101, 104, 104, 77, 89, 88, 104, 96, 82, 70, 89, 91, 39, 103, 93, 85, 104, 104, 81, 67, 104, 104, 104, 87, 104, 89, 78, 104, 86, 76, 103, 102, 80, 45, 94, 104, 104, 76, 80, 72, 73 calculate a 95% confidence interval on the standard deviation of time until a tumor appearance. check the assumption of normality of the population and comment on the assumptions for the confidence interval
